Our brains optimize for survival, not archiving. Without cues, fragments slip down the forgetting curve within days. Attach a reason, a link to ongoing work, and a next tiny action. Revisit briefly while the memory is fresh. These small, intentional touches reduce friction and let your quick notes keep working when motivation wanes.
A sentence without why is a stranded island. Record where you were, what problem you faced, and which project might benefit next. Add one sentence about why future-you should care. When you return, that breadcrumb trail invites reconnection, transforming a lonely line into a usable doorway back into meaningful momentum.
